During lytic replication of Kaposi’s sarcoma-associated herpesvirus (KSHV), a nuclear viral long noncoding RNA known as PAN RNA becomes the most abundant polyadenylated transcript in the cell. Knockout or knockdown of KSHV PAN RNA results in loss of late lytic viral gene expression and, consequently, reduction of progeny virion release from the cell. We studied KSHV and RRV PAN RNA homologs using capture hybridization analysis of RNA targets (CHART) and observed their reproducible associations with host chromatin, but the loci differ between PAN RNA homologs. Overall design: Examination of the binding sites of viral PAN RNA in KSHV-infected BCBL-1 cells and RRV-infected BJAB-RRV cells. Latent samples, as well as three timepoints of lytic viral induction were analyzed for each cell type (BCBL-1: 16 hr, 24 hr and 48 hr; BJAB-RRV: 18 hr, 24 hr, 36 hr).
